jut be careful with the thermometers that the temp is on the background and not on the actual thermo, the backing can move

INCUBATOR-THERMOMETER-LG.jpg



and that can be the reason the temp is so off ;)

So orginally had 21 Eggs in the bator.
Last night candled them all.

Of the original 15 silkie eggs given to me, one had a blood ring. All other 14 are developing.

Of the 4 silkie eggs that came from the fridge (my old silkie's egg), one is a dud, completely clear. Another had a blood ring, and last two are developing. So two of those left.

I also happened to check in the nesting box, to see if by any chance there were the ebay shipped eggs my broody was setting on before she was killed. Of 7 only two were not cracked. I put those two in the bator as well, and they are both developing.
